Boat Tour of Eagle Nest Lake and Dam
Service Description
The Eagle Nest Lake boat tour is a great way to explore the area’s natural history, including biodiversity and geology, as well as the unique relationship between the Nothern and Southern Rocky Mountains, Eagle Nest Dam and the watershed below the Cimarron Canyon. You’ll also learn about the surrounding wildlife habitat and enjoy views of Wheeler, Baldy and Touch Me Not peaks. The tours are approximately 1.5 hours long and are offered daily starting June 20th – September 30th, weather permitting. The boat tours start at the south boat launch of Eagle Nest Lake State Park. The Eagle Nest Lake State Park Learning Center has picturesque walking trails, a restroom and an interpretive center. Come join us for a beautiful and informative tour of this great natural resource.
